NH HB295 | 2015 | Regular Session

Status

Spectrum: Partisan Bill (Republican 6-0)
Status: Introduced on January 8 2015 - 25% progression, died in chamber
Action: 2015-11-12 - Committee Report: Ought to Pass with Amendment #2015-2387h (NT) for Jan 6 (Vote 13-0; Consent Calendar); House Calendar 67, PG. 9
Text: Latest bill text (Introduced) [HTML]

Summary

Removing a reference in the housing law to municipal agreements regarding the construction of parking facilities.
